Registration Is Open  for a Field Visit Tour,  To Abu Saiba archaeological  site

 

Bahrain Authority for Culture & Antiquities is planning a field visit tour to Abu Saiba archaeological  site, on 29 March 2019. The aim of the visit is to discover the results of the archaeological excavations of the French Expedition team, made up of experts, specialists in excavations and archeological heritage research. Since 2017, the French Archaeological Mission in Bahrain is exploring the Tylos civilization in Bahrain, which developed about 2000 years after Dilmun. A major necropolis of this period is presently on study at Abu Saiba, where more than 40 impressive built graves have been identified up to now, and about 20 carefully excavated by the French archaeologists and a bio-anthropologist. Antique looting is important, but these graves reveal unusual aspects of Bahrain’s ancient life.
